It regulates sebum production and shine, combats enlarged pores, and mattifies the complexion with a matte effect.
Size: 50ml

HOW TO USE

Apply morning and evening to cleansed, dry skin.

Regulates sebum production with a mattifying effect
Soothes and calms impure skin
Pore ​​astringent activity

A hydrating and sebum-regulating face cream that regulates sebum production, addressing acne symptoms and redness thanks to the action of iris extract, vitamin A, and zinc salt, active ingredients with astringent and decongestant properties. It has a mattifying effect and is an excellent base for makeup.

Aqua, Corn starch modified, Diethylhexyl carbonate, Glycerin, Hexyl laurate, Propanediol, Coconut/palm kernel alkanes, Isodecyl neopentanoate, Niacinamide, Ammonium acryloyldimethyltaurate/VP copolymer, Betaine, Olea europaea fruit oil, Iris florentina root extract, Retinyl palmitate, Tocopherol, Zinc sulfate, Hydroxyacetophenone, Sodium stearoyl glutamate, Caprylyl glycol, Parfum, Xanthan gum, 1,2-Hexanediol, Alcohol denat., Beta-sitosterol, Squalene.

The skin is soothed and mattified, without the annoying greasy effect
